An educational program is seeking a Substitute Paraprofessional to provide short-term instructional and behavioral support to students. This role ensures continuity of learning and a structured, safe environment during staff absences.
Responsibilities / Duties :
Assist teachers with classroom instruction, supervision, and daily learning activities
Provide one-on-one or small-group support to students with academic or behavioral needs
Implement strategies outlined in Individualized Education Programs (IEPs) or behavior plans
Monitor and document student progress, participation, and behavior
Support classroom routines, transitions, and organization
Maintain confidentiality and follow school policies and safety procedures
Complete required school fingerprinting and background checks before assignment
Qualifications / Desired Experience :
High school diploma or equivalent required; college coursework in education preferred
Prior experience as a paraprofessional, instructional aide, or childcare provider preferred
Strong communication, patience, and adaptability in classroom settings
Dependable and able to work flexible substitute assignments
Willingness to complete required fingerprinting and background clearance
